A Fire Almost Stopped the Tucker Boutique From Opening

A new Tucker boutique was planned for the West Village in the spring of 2012, but this summer, there was a fire in the design studio, so founder Gaby Basora had to find a new location. According to a press release, she "spent the subsequent weeks scouring the city on her bike," and ended up finding one at 355 West Broadway.

The store is now officially open, and the space also houses the new Tucker design studio. Large front windows let in an abundance of natural light, and there's antique furniture covered in fabric remnants of original Tucker printed silks. As you may recall, Tucker previously had a store on the LES that was a little too tiny for Basora's liking, which is why we think the spacious West Broadway is a better fit for all that print.

Update: A Tucker rep tells us that the store on the LES was actually just a pop-up, thus the West Broadway location marks the brand's first official boutique.
